What is the difference between the older LifeStraw Go water filter bottle and the new Go Series water filter bottle?

Many of the most loved aspects of the previous generation bottles have been carried over with thoughtful redesigns to improve user experience.


The new Go Series bottles retain the class-leading filtration capabilities of our previous generation bottles incorporating both a membrane microfilter and an activated carbon filter. The two-stage system filters out bacteria, parasites, microplastics, and reduces turbidity as well as improving taste and reducing some chemicals.

Additionally, our new Go Series bottles continue to use BPA- Free resins and high-quality 18/8 grade stainless steel for durability, worry-free use, and in the case of our steel bottles – a layer of insulation to keep cool water cool.


The new bottle has a redesigned cap, mouthpiece, and assembly. The cap incorporates a leak-proof lid with a handle making it easy to carry while also protecting the silicon mouthpiece from the elements. The mouthpiece can be twisted off to remove for easy washing or replacement.

The filter connection for the cap has also been redesigned. In previous generations, the filter was a press-fit attachment. For new bottles, the filter is now a screw-in connection. This is important to know if you are purchasing replacement filters in the future to ensure you get the right version of the filter for you bottle.


Finally the new Go series comes with an additional larger 1L size option in our double-wall insulated stainless steel bottles and there is a large assortment of new fresh colors across the line.
